Alan Ruck

Biography

Alan Ruck is an American actor celebrated for his extensive career in film, television, and theater. Known for his versatility and memorable screen presence, he has remained a respected figure in the entertainment industry for more than four decades.

 

 

Early Life and Education

Alan Douglas Ruck was born on July 1, 1956, in Cleveland, Ohio, United States. He developed an interest in acting during his youth and later attended the University of Illinois, where he studied drama. His formal training provided a strong foundation for a career that would span stage productions, feature films, and television series.

 

 

Career

Ruck first gained widespread recognition for his portrayal of Cameron Frye in the classic comedy film Ferris Bueller's Day Off. His performance as the anxious yet lovable best friend of Ferris Bueller became one of the most memorable roles of the 1980s and remains a fan favorite today.

Following that success, he appeared in numerous films, including Speed, Twister, and Cheaper by the Dozen. His ability to move between comedy and drama helped him build a diverse acting portfolio.

In television, Ruck achieved renewed acclaim for his role as Connor Roy in the award-winning HBO series Succession. His portrayal of the eccentric eldest son of the Roy family earned critical praise and introduced him to a new generation of viewers.
